The Strategy, Regulatory Affairs & Business Transformation Director holds global accountability for development of the RWE Offshore wind strategy. Furthermore, you will provide market, regulatory and competitive intelligence to the Board and senior management team and set political and regulatory priorities related to the Offshore business and execute advocacy activities in close alignment within RWE Group. Moreover, you will support business development and strategic initiatives and hold accountability for building the capabilities of the organization through mindsets and ways of working. You will ensure high quality performance management, problem-solving and continuous process improvement by managing process excellence and transformation projects. You will also oversee the development of the digital strategy and roadmap for the offshore business. Additionally, you will be responsible for creating and delivering the sustainability strategy throughout the Offshore Business in line the RWE Group Sustainability agenda.

About the role

  • Conducting insightful strategic analyses with the aim to formulate the strategic direction comprising technology, market, and business model scope as well as mid- and long-term business targets for the Offshore business
  • Delivering special projects related to our strategic priorities
  • Gathering business intelligence across all relevant markets, value chain steps, and competitors
  • Shaping the regulatory agenda, defining priorities and positions, and aligning external positions within the RWE Group
  • Following regulatory and legislative developments and delivering assessments of implications for the Offshore wind business; Acting as host unit for regulatory teams in Europe and APAC for the Onshore wind, PV and Battery Storage technologies to align regulatory positions across RES technologies
  • Executing advocacy discussions and trends, incl. representation in national / regional / local associations to promote RWE’s positions
  • Implementing RWE Offshore’s cultural priorities and change initiatives, providing support to all departments in identifying and realizing process excellence and performance analysis
  • Supporting the Offshore Leadership Team within their learning and change journey
  • Developing the digital strategy and roadmap, prioritizing digital initiatives to maximize business impact
  • Delivering the sustainability agenda in Offshore Wind by shaping specific mid- to long-term ambitions and targets, maintaining and monitoring the implementation roadmap, incl. prioritizing sustainability projects and pilots and delivery of selected initiatives
  • Coordinating the sustainability reporting

RWE Offshore Wind, a subsidiary of RWE AG, is one of the world’s leading players in the field of offshore wind. We have more than 20 years of experience in the development, construction, and efficient operation of offshore wind farms. We currently operate 19 offshore wind farms, making us the second largest operator worldwide in terms of total capacity. We are currently building four additional wind farms with a combined capacity of nearly 4.9 GW and are developing numerous other projects.

RWE Offshore Wind tests a wide variety of new technologies in our offshore wind farms, enabling these plants to operate more efficiently and economically.
